Question

A candy stall in a mall that was cleaned and all the chametz was removed today – is Bedikat Chametz required there?

Answer

Shalom u’vracha 

I do not know exactly what type of stall is involved, so I will answer in general terms. 

General cleaning is not the same as Bedikat Chametz, since it is possible that some areas remain uncleaned. 

However, if it is a smooth surface, or something that can be turned over and shaken out, then the place does not contain chametz and does not require a bedika (inspection).
